Greek Village on the East Side
Short Orders
During the building boom of the last decade, a pizzeria was tucked into
the corner of a new condo in the heart of the old East Side. Now, the spot is
home to Greek Village Gyros (1888 N. Humboldt Ave.), which serves an array of
fast and ready Greek favorites—gyros, spinach pies, kabobs, veggie pitas and
dolmades—along with American staples. For a cross-cultural experience, try the
Greek burger with feta, oregano, tomato and black olives. With the restaurant’s
faux marble walls and high ceiling, you could almost think you were in Athens.
Better yet, while the weather is warm, eat at a table on the curbside patio,
screened from the busy street by potted flowers and green plants. Greek Village
is popular in the neighborhood for carry-outs.
